Major wildfires burning across Los Angeles

Published

on

www.youtube.com – WKRN News 2 – 2025-01-08 16:46:39

SUMMARY: Four major wildfires are raging in the Los Angeles area, destroying thousands of structures and burning over 7,000 acres. The Etienne fire has claimed at least two lives, with scenes described as apocalyptic as smoke blankets the valleys. Hurricane-strength winds complicate firefighting efforts, grounding helicopters and forcing residents to fight flames with buckets of water. A senior assisted living facility was lost, though all 90 residents were evacuated safely. The LA County Fire Department was unprepared for multiple concurrent fires, and President Biden received updates from emergency responders while the California National Guard deployed trained troops to assist.

Two people are dead, many have been hurt, and more than 1,000 structures have been destroyed by multiple massive wildfires tearing across the Los Angeles area, authorities said Wednesday.

Intense storms downed power lines, left thousands in the dark across the Mid-South

Published

on

www.youtube.com – FOX13 Memphis – 2025-07-18 14:11:19

SUMMARY: Intense storms in southeast Memphis caused 13 power poles to fall along Shelby Drive near Getwell, leaving thousands without power. MLGW and Memphis Police have blocked affected roads due to live power lines posing a significant danger. One downed line even crushed a car, though the driver is expected to be okay. The outages have impacted many homes and businesses in the area amidst extreme heat, complicating recovery efforts. Utility crews are working through the night to clear debris and restore power, with no estimated timeline for repairs yet. Authorities have closed a half-mile stretch of the road for safety.

Alvarado echoes Trump in launching a congressional bid

Published

on

wpln.org – Tony Gonzalez – 2025-07-18 04:38:00

SUMMARY: Dr. Ralph Alvarado, Kentucky’s first Hispanic state legislator and former Republican state senator, announced his 2026 bid for Kentucky’s 6th Congressional District seat. Now Tennessee’s health commissioner, Alvarado plans to return and align with Trump’s “America First” agenda, focusing on issues like border security and fighting the “woke agenda.” The seat, held by GOP Rep. Andy Barr, is a Democratic target for the 2026 midterms. The race includes GOP challengers Ryan Dotson and Deanna Gordon, and Democrats Zach Dembo, Cherlynn Stevenson, and David Kloiber. The district blends rural GOP areas and Democratic-leaning Lexington, shaped by recent redistricting.

A heart implant could make Tennessee’s next execution painful and prolonged. Prison officials argue they don’t have to disable the device.

Published

on

wpln.org – Catherine Sweeney – 2025-07-17 17:25:00

SUMMARY: Byron Black, scheduled for execution in Tennessee on August 5, has a heart implant—a combined pacemaker and defibrillator—that could cause severe pain by delivering shocks if triggered during lethal injection. Experts warn that the drug pentobarbital used in the execution may induce dangerous heart rhythms activating the device, causing continuous shocks. Black’s attorneys argue the device should be disabled beforehand, but state officials and medical experts claim it’s unlikely to be triggered and that any shocks would be felt in a coma state, preventing pain perception. A court ruling on this issue is expected soon.
